This globally recognized qualification is taken by hundreds of thousands of non-native speakers every year. According to Cambridge Assessment International Education, the 0511 syllabus is designed to develop practical communication skills for study and work. Unlike some other IGCSE English exams, 0511 includes a count-in speaking component, meaning your oral performance directly contributes to your final grade. This makes it an excellent choice for students who need to prove they can actually use English in real conversations, not just read and write.

What You Will Learn

The course follows the official Cambridge IGCSE ESL (0511) curriculum and covers all four papers:

Component Focus Weighting (Count-in Speaking)
Paper 1 – Reading and Writing Comprehending texts, writing for specific purposes 60%
Paper 2 – Listening Understanding spoken English in various contexts 20%
Component 3 – Speaking Role plays, discussions, presentations 20%
